Marriage Procession of the Sultan's Daughter, at Constantinople, 1854. Celebrations for the wedding of Fatma Sultan, aged 14, and Ali Galip Pasha. 'The nuptials of Fathma Sultane and Ali Gholib Pacha...have just been celebrated, with great magnificence...at the Palace of Baltaliman. [Taking part in the procession were:]...A band of music on horseback...Turkish Grandees, in suits splendidly embroidered with gold, and riding fine Arabian horses...The Sheik-ul-Islam (Turkish Pope), in snow-white garments...A number of Eunuchs. The [bride's] golden carriage, drawn by six fine English black horsess...the Chief of the Eunuchs, his breast covered with stars and cordons; he wears a General's epaulettes, and his dress is embroidered all over...the Chief of Ulemas, an aged man dressed in white...servants on foot, wearing the Sultan's livery...'. From "Illustrated London News", 1854.
